So I finally got my Loki Prime and what better weapon to level him with than my Glave Prime with the Astral Twilight stance. it was all fine and dandy until i suddenly died and i didn't know why. None of my fingers were even close to the channel botton, so I couldn't have detonated it mid flight. I noticed it kept happening in in enclosed spaces where the Glave Prime bounced a lot and and mostly when i was standing still. in other words, I my own weapon kills me when it ricochets off something. Upon further testing it happens only while I have Power Throw equiped on it

 

 

Is this supposed to happen? And does this happen to anyone else?

This is very much intended, that is why Quick Return and Power Throw work so well together. It's basically a free (limited) range grenade. From my personal experience it's a truly high-risk, high-reward skillshot. Lob it into a group of people charging at you and watch the first get cut in half while the rest blow up for some apparent reason.

 

It's also (partly) what made Gleaming Talon expensive (Aside from abysmal drop rate from a super rare enemy). Since I'm fairly certain you need a stance mod to allow it to do this as well.
